  • SpottedKittySpottedKitty Posts: 7,232
    edited December 1969

    Automatic Autofit depends on Fit-to also working automatically. Most new(-ish) clothes will fit-to onto the figure properly when you load them into the scene, but many older clothes just load and sit there. You have to fit-to onto the figure manually, which will invoke Autofit, and everything should then work as it's supposed to. It's nothing wrong with Autofit, it's just what happens with clothes designed and made for Poser — DAZ|Studio can convert them, but Autofit won't work automatically if it doesn't fit-to.
